Description

The port uses a commit that is four months old. Even at the time the port was created, it was only about a month newer than the stable version port (gimp2). With the passage of time, the gimp2-devel port increasingly does not represent the current state of the development version of GIMP 2.10.

Maybe it is just a matter of education, or that I missed reading something. I assumed that the port would pull the latest, nightly version, whenever the port was built. Maybe I am supposed to edit the port file myself, to change the pulled version. Maybe you could put a comment in the port file, or in the documentation for Macports explaining the purpose of ports with the "-devel" nomenclature. I suppose if a port file pulled the latest commit every time it was built, it would be nearly impossible to keep track of defects.

(Also, when I browsed Macports, the "devel" category, it did not seem to find gimp2-devel.)

Related to another issue that I will create a ticket for, the "gimp2" port is missing a patch for "unable to open script-fu-int".

Just to explain the context, when I first used the gimp2 port, I found that issue. So I thought, "get the gimp2-devel port, it will have all the latest GIMP commits." But it doesn't, and I later found that there is a commit in GIMP that fixes the issue.
